Child pages
  • High Performance Computing (HPC) Boot Camp - June 6-9th, 2017

The Tufts High Performance Compute (HPC) cluster delivers 35,845,920 cpu hours and 59,427,840 gpu hours of free compute time per year to the user community.

Teraflops: 60+ (60+ trillion floating point operations per second) cpu: 4000 cores gpu: 6784 cores Interconnect: 40GB low latency ethernet

For additional information, please contact Research Technology Services at tts-research@tufts.edu


Skip to end of metadata
Go to start of metadata

High Performance Computing (HPC) Boot Camp - June 6-9th, 2017


High Performance Computing (HPC) Summer Boot Camp - OpenACC, OpenMP, OpenMPI (FREE, FREE, FREE)

Training: In conjunction with the Pittsburgh Supercomputer Center (PSC), Tufts is offering a week long summer boot camp bringing together many of the technologies in High Performance Compute (HPC) programming. GPU accelerators (OpenACC), single node scaling (OpenMP) and cluster wide scaling (OpenMPI) will be covered along with parallel development, debugging tools. The week will culminate with a discussion of hybrid computing, to show how all the technologies fit together, as well as the announcement of a post boot camp competition.

Seats will go fast, so sign up early and join the Research Technology (RT) staff for an excellent week of free training. These workshops are sponsored by the National Science Foundation (NSF) funded eXstreme Science and Engineering Discovery Environment (XSEDE). Please feel free to forward email.

Signup: https://portal.xsede.org/course-calendar/-/training-user/class/559/session/1279

Details:https://wikis.uit.tufts.edu/confluence/display/TuftsUITResearchComputing/XSEDE+Events

Date: Four days, Tuesday - Friday, June 6-9, 2017

Location: Collaborative Learning and Innovation Complex, Room 114, 574 Boston Ave Medford, MA 02155

Audience: All faculty, student and staff.

Contact: For further information or questions email shawn.doughty@tufts.edu


Agenda
Tuesday June 6
11:00 Welcome
11:15 Computing Environment
11:45 Intro to Parallel Computing
12:30 Intro to OpenMP
1:30 Lunch break
2:30 Exercise 1 (zip folder of all exercises)
3:15 More OpenMP
4:30 Exercise 2
5:00 Adjourn
Wednesday June 7
11:00 Intro to OpenACC
12:00 Exercise 1
12:30 Introduction to OpenACC (cont.)
1:00 Lunch break
2:00 Exercise 2
2:45 Introduction to OpenACC (cont.)
3:00 Using OpenACC with CUDA Libraries
3:30 Advanced OpenACC
4:00 OpenMP 4.0 Sneak Peek
5:00 Adjourn
Thursday June 8
11:00 Introduction to MPI
1:00 Lunch break
2:00 Intro exercises
3:10 Intro exercises review
3:15 Scalable Programming: Laplace code
3:45 Laplace Exercise
5:00 Adjourn
Friday June 9
11:00 Laplace Exercise (Cont)
12:30 Laplace Solution
1:00 Lunch break
2:00 Advanced MPI
3:00 Outro to Parallel Computing
4:00 Parallel Tools
4:20 Hybrid Computing
4:40 Hybrid Competition
5:00 Adjourn

 

 


  • No labels